We are looking for new members of our University's governing body to join our community and help shape our future success.
In evaluating progress against our ambitions, we are proud to be Gold rated in the Teaching Excellence Framework 2017. We're also in the top 20 for research excellence in the Research Excellence Framework 2014, top 15 in England for student satisfaction (National Student Survey 2017) and ranked as the 15th most international university in the world (Times Higher Education April 2017). Financially we are operating from a position of strength, with continued growth in our annual surplus, ongoing investment in our world-class estate and an annual contribution to the UK economy of over GBP 500m.
To maintain our competitive edge, during a period of unprecedented change for the higher education sector, we need to continue to think and act in different ways. We are therefore seeking to enhance further the expertise and diversity of our University Council, our principal governing body, through the recruitment of new Council Members. We are seeking outstanding individuals with the requisite intellectual capacity, commercial acumen and strategic leadership experience to support us in shaping our transformational agenda.
